About the Role

The Sales & Marketing Specialist will support the daily operations of the Sales & Marketing Department through administrative, financial, sales support, and marketing functions. This role serves as a key coordinator, ensuring efficient office operations and assisting with the execution of sales initiatives, marketing programs, promotional activities, and special projects.

Responsibilities

  • Manage and oversee payroll administration for the Sales & Marketing department.
  • Process departmental invoices, expense reports, purchase orders, contracts, and vendor payments.
  • Reconcile sales commissions and maintain supporting documentation.
  • Assist with departmental budgeting, expense tracking, forecasting, and monthly reporting.
  • Manage departmental purchasing, office supplies, promotional inventory, and marketing collateral inventory.
  • Coordinate departmental travel arrangements, registrations, and travel expense tracking.
  • Maintain organized records, contracts, files, and department documentation.
  • Prepare presentations, reports, proposals, correspondence, and other business materials for department leadership.
  • Coordinate calendars, meetings, agendas, and follow-up on departmental action items.
  • Manage incoming sales leads and ensure proper assignment and tracking within Delphi, Salesforce, and other sales systems.
  • Assist with group turnover processes and coordination between Sales, Revenue Management, and Operations teams.
  • Maintain databases, CRM systems, account records, and sales activity reporting.
  • Assist with site inspections, client visits, familiarization trips, sales missions, and trade shows.
  • Manage charitable donation requests, gift certificate tracking, sales amenities, and promotional programs.
  • Monitor market trends, competitor activity, and industry developments and provide research and reporting to department leadership.
  • Support the Director of Marketing with the execution of all marketing campaigns, promotions, partnerships, and public relations initiatives.
  • Create and update presentations, flyers, signage, email communications, promotional materials, and other branded collateral.
  • Assist with basic graphic design projects while ensuring compliance with brand standards.
  • Coordinate marketing projects with outside agencies, vendors, photographers, designers, printers, and community partners.
  • Assist with website content updates, digital marketing initiatives, and social media scheduling.
  • Manage photography assets, content libraries, and marketing resource files.
  • Monitor and support online reputation management efforts, including review responses and third-party platform messaging.
  • Assist in the planning and execution of hotel events, activations, sponsorships, partnerships, and community outreach initiatives.
  • Track and report on marketing campaign performance, promotional activity, and special event results.
  • Participate in hotel meetings, departmental meetings, training sessions, and special projects as directed by the Director of Sales & Marketing.
  • Maintain effective communication with guests, clients, vendors, and hotel team members at all times.
  • Perform other duties and special assignments as requested by management.
